Aims
To update inland enforcement officers on imported food issues.
Objectives
This course seeks to provide delegates with:
- An overview of imported food controls
- A review of the Trade in Animals and Related Products Regulations 2011 (TARP Regs)
- An update on imports of foods not of animal origin from third countries.
- Guidance on enforcement issues
